Comparing Luxembourg with California, United States

Compare Climate information for Luxembourg and California, United States

Is Luxembourg warmer or hotter than California, United States?

On average across the year, no, Luxembourg is not hotter than California, United States . Luxembourg has an average temperature of 10°C/50°F and California, United States has an average temperature of 18°C/64°F.

Luxembourg's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 23°C/73°F, which is not hotter than California, United States's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).

Is Luxembourg colder or cooler than California, United States?

On average across the year, yes, Luxembourg is colder than California, United States . Luxembourg has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F and California, United States has an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F.



Luxembourg's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of 0°C/32°F, which is colder than California, United States's coldest month (December, with an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F).

Does Luxembourg have more rain than California, United States?

On average across the year, yes, Luxembourg has more rain than California, United States. Luxembourg has an average annual rainfall of 863mm and California, United States has an average annual rainfall of 261mm.

Luxembourg's wettest month is December, with an average monthly rainfall of 92mm, which is wetter than California, United States's wettest month (also December, with an average monthly rainfall of 56mm).
